Minute One: The Breath of the Mind Reader

Also known as: Stop. Breathe. Hijack Reality.

Close your eyes. Don’t worry, I wont nick your socks.

Now inhale through your nose for 4 seconds, hold it for 4 seconds, then exhale slowly through your mouth for 8 seconds.

Do that three times.

That’s it, that’s the spell and here’s what just happened:

Your heart rate dropped and your brain waves shifted out of panic mode.

Your parasympathetic nervous system lit up like a neon sign.

But most importantly, your prefrontal cortex; The part of your brain responsible for focus, decision making and not blurting out

“I’m psychic” during Coronation street, came back online.

Mentalists talk about being in the moment.

But being in the moment requires you to breathe through the noise.

This simple breath ritual acts like a psychic circuit breaker allowing you interrupt the storm and reclaim your clarity. It’s a signal to your unconscious that you’re no longer reacting to chaos… You’re directing it!

Mentis Tip:

Visualise your breath as a smoky ink being drawn into your body. Dark and mysterious. Each exhale releases the nonsense and leaves only focus.

Minute Two: The Sigil of the Week

Also known as: Draw something that doesn’t exist.

Grab a pen, any pen. But not the one you had up your nose, yes I saw you!

Now grab your Mentalist journal of magical recalibration

You’ve got one of those, haven’t you?

Now draw a symbol that represents how you want to feel this week.

Hold your horses cowboy, theirs a  twist:

Don’t use recognisable shapes. No smiley faces and definitely no stars.

Let your hand move like it’s being guided by a future version of you who’s already won the week over. This is your personal sigil.

It’s raw, abstract and a bit weird but we like weird here!

It might end up looking like a clock being struck by lightning.

But this is powerful stuff, because it represents intention made visual and the human brain thrive on symbols.

We’re not trying to paint a Van Gogh here. This isn’t art…

It’s what I like to call NeuroMagic.

By crafting a sigil, you’re bypassing your monkey mind

and sending a clear message to your subconscious:

“I’ll decide how this week goes.”

Place it somewhere visible; Inside your wallet, taped to your laptop or tattooed on your left eyeball. Although I don’t recommended the last one unless you’re a goth warlock with an extremely high pain threshold!

Mentis Tip:

Charge your sigil with emotion. After you’ve drawn it, stare at it for 10 seconds and feel the result you want. Then forget about it. That’s the secret.

The subconscious mind does the rest.

Minute Three: The Whisper of the Future Self

Also known as: Channel the you that’s already won.

Close your eyes again. I know, you’re doing a lot of eye closing today

but it’s how we sneak past the rational brain.

Imagine it’s Friday night and the week has already passed.

And you’ve done everything you needed to do.

You nailed the gigs.

You updated your social media.

You practiced that new routine and you feel fantastic.

You owned the week.

Now… Ask your Friday Self one question:

“What did I do differently this week to become this person?”

Now listen, seriously.

Just wait for an answer. It might come as a word. A feeling.

A whisper that says “stop scrolling Instagram and do the thing.”

Whatever you hear, write it down.

That’s your compass for the week.

It’s not wu wu or mystical mumbo jumbo.

It’s neurolinguistic time travelling.

When you project yourself into the future and feel the result, you activate the same neural networks as if it’s already happened.

You turn goals into memories and memories are much harder to ignore than a bunch of vague intentions.

Mentis Tip:

Give your future self a name. Mine’s “The veil splitter of the ninth eye.” He wears velvet and smells like Jean Paul Gaultier and ambition!
